课后习题答案选择题

上传人:l**** 文档编号:43782095 上传时间:2018-06-07 格式:DOCX 页数:24 大小:176.32KB
返回 下载 相关 举报
课后习题答案选择题_第1页
第1页 / 共24页
课后习题答案选择题_第2页
第2页 / 共24页
课后习题答案选择题_第3页
第3页 / 共24页
课后习题答案选择题_第4页
第4页 / 共24页
课后习题答案选择题_第5页
第5页 / 共24页
点击查看更多>>
资源描述

《课后习题答案选择题》由会员分享,可在线阅读,更多相关《课后习题答案选择题(24页珍藏版)》请在金锄头文库上搜索。

1、1、下面不是 VB 工作模式的是(C )A设计模式B运行模式C编模汇式D中断模式2、可视化编程的最大优点是(C )A具有标准工具箱B一个工程文件由若干个窗体文件组成C不需要编写大量代码来描述图形对象D所见即所得3、下列不能打开属性窗口的操作是(C )A执行“视图”菜单中的“属性窗口”命令B按 F4 键 C按 Ctrl+TD单击工具栏上的“属性窗口”按钮4、下列可以打开立即窗口的操作是(D )ACtrl+D BCtrl+E CCtrl+F DCtrl+G5、Visual Basic 的编程机制是(D )A可视化 B面向对象 C面向图形 D事件驱动1、以下能够触发文本框 Change 事件的操作是

2、(D )A文本框失去焦点B文本框获得焦点C设置文本框的焦点D改变文本框的内容2、应用程序设计完成后,应将程序保存,保存的过程是(D )A只保存窗体文件即可B只保存工程文件即可C先保存工程文件,之后保存窗体文件D先保存窗体文件(或标准模块文件) ,之后还要保存工程文件3、VB 应用程序的运行模式是( C)A解释运行模式B编译运行模式C两者都有D汇编模式4、任何控件都具有的属性是(C )ATEXTBCAPTIONCNAMEDFORECOLOR5、决定控件上文字的字体、字形、大小及效果的属性是(D )ATEXTBCAPTIONCNAMEDFONT6、在窗体上建立了多个控件,如 TEXT、LABEL1

3、、COMMAND1,若要使程序一运行焦点就定位在 COMMAND1 控件上,应将 COMMAND1 控件的(B )设置为 0AINDEXBTABINDEXCTABSTOPDENABLED7、运行时,当用户向文本框输入新的内容,或在程序代码中对文本框的 TEXT 属性进行赋值从而改变了文本框的 TEXT 属性值时,将触发文本框的( D)事件ACLICKBDBLCLICKCGOTFOCUSDCHANGE8、在运行时,按 TAB 键跳过了一个可以获得焦点的控件(如文本框) ,则可能是因为(D )A该控件的 TABSTOP 属性值为 TRUE B该控件的 TABINDEX 属性值为FALSEC该控件的

4、 ENABLED 属性值为 TRUE D该控件的 ENABLED 属性值为FALSE9、为了防止用户随意将光标置于控件上,应(D )A将控件的 TABINDEX 属性设置为 0B将控件的 TABSTOP 属性设置为 TRUEC将控件的 TABSTOP 属性设置为 FALSED将控件的 ENABLED 属性设置为 FALSE10、若要使标签控件显示时,不覆盖其背景内容,应设置标签控件的(D )属性ABACKCOLORBBORDERSTYLECFORECOLORDBACKSTYLE11、如果要在文本框中输入字符时,只显示某个字符,如星号(*) ,运行时,在文本框中输入的字符仍然显示出来,而不显示星

5、号,原因可能是(B )A文本框的 MULTILINE 属性值为 TRUEB文本框的 LOCKED 属性值为 TRUEC文本框的 MULTILINE 属性值为 FALSED文本框的 LOCKED 属性为 FALSE12、在运行阶段,要在文本框 TEXT1 获得焦点时选中文本框中所有内容,对应的事件过程是( A)APrivate Sub Text1_GotFocus( )Text1.SelStart=0Text1.Sellength=Len(Text1.Text)End SubBPrivate Sub Text1_LostFocus( )Text1.SelStart=0Text1.Sellengt

6、h=Len(Text1.Text)End SubCPrivate Sub Text1_Change( )Text1.SelStart=0Text1.Sellength=Len(Text1.Text)End SubDPrivate Sub Text1_SetFocus( )Text1.SelStart=0Text1.Sellength=Len(Text1.Text)End Sub13、Visual Basic 继承了 Basic 语言简单易用的语法特点,同时支持面向对象的编程机制,其中构成其控件(对象)的三要素是( D)A属性、事件、事件过程 B控件、窗体、事件C属性、过程、方法 D属性、事件、

7、方法14、决定标签(Label)显示的属性是(C )AText BName CCaption DAlignment15、命令按钮的标题文字由(B )属性来设置。AText BCaption CName D(名称)16、若要设置文本的显示颜色,则可用(B )属性来实现。ABackColor BForecolor CFillColor DBackstyle17、在运行时,若要调用某命令钮的 Click 事件过程,则可设置该命令钮对象的(B )属性为 Ture 来实现。AEnabled BValue CDefault DCancel18、在运行时,若要获得用户在文本框中所选择的文本,可通过访问( D

8、)属性来实现。ASelStart BSelLenght CText DSelText1、以下哪个是合法的变量( D )ArightBabc123C123_abcDab123c2、下列说法错误的是( B )A在同一模块不同过程中的变量可以同名B不同模块中定义的全局变量不可以同名C引用另一模块中的全局变量时,必须在变量名前加模块名D同一模块中不同级的变量可以同名3、把 MsgBox 的返回值转换为数值应该使用的函数是(D )ALog BStr CLen DVal4、语句 DIM AA(3,4,5)中定义的数组有( C )个元素A12 B60 C120 D3455、下面程序运行后输出的结果是( B

9、)A$=“CHINA“B$=STRING$(3,A$)PRINT B$ENDACHI BCCC CINA DAAA6、以下语句的输出结果是( C )Print Format$(32548.5, “000,000.00“)A32548.5 B325,485.00 C032,548,50 D32,548,507、以下叙述中错误的是(D )A如果过程被定义为 Static 类型,则该过程中的局部变量都是 Static 类型BSub 过程中不能嵌套定义 Sub 过程CSub 过程中可以嵌套调用 Sub 过程D事件过程可以像通用过程一样由用户定义过程名8、Visual Basic 提供的 On Erro

10、r Resume next 错误陷阱语句表示( C )A当发生错误时,使程序转跳到语句标号为 0 的程序块B当发生错误时,不使用错误处理程序块C当发生错误时,忽略错误行,继续执行下一语句D当发生错误时,终止本过程执行,继续执行下一过程9、在 Visual Basic 中,若要将控制权交给操作系统则通过( D )的语句。AEnd BExit Do CExit Sub DDo Events10、在 Visual Basic 中语句的续行号采用( A )A空格与下划线 B下划线与空格 C空格与短线 D短线与空格11、假定有以下程序段:For i=1 to 3For j=5 to 1 Step 1Pr

11、int i*jNext j,i则语句 Print i*j 的执行次数是( A )A15 B.16 C17 D1812、从键盘上输入两个字符串,分别保存在变量 str1、str2 中。确定第二个字符串在第一个字符串中起始位置的函数是( D )ALeft BMid CString DInstr13、如果将布尔常量值 TRUE 赋值给一个整型变量,则整型变量的值为(B )A0B-1CTRUEDFALSE14、下列叙述不正确的是(B )A注释语句是非执行语句,仅对程序的内容起注释作用,它不被解释和编译B注释语句可以放在代码中的任何位置C注释语句不能放在续行符的后面D代码中加入注释语句的目的是提高程序的

12、可读性15、语句 PRINT “INT(-13.2)”;INT(-13.2)的输出结果为( D)AINT(-13.2)= -13.2BINT(-13.2)= 13.2CINT(-13.2)= -13DINT(-13.2)= -1416、如果 TAB 函数的参数小于 1,则打印位置在第( B)列A0B1C2D317、变量未赋值时,数值型变量的值为( A)A、0B空C1D无任何值18、下列语句中正确的是(D )Atxt1.text+txt2.text=txt3.textBcommand1.name=cmdokC12label.caption=1234Da=inputbox(“hello”)19、假

13、设变量 BOOLVAR 是一个布尔型变量,则下面正确的赋值语句是( D)ABOOLVAR=TRUEBBOOLVAR=.TRUECBOOLVAR=#TRUE#DBOOLVAR=320判断循环结构的类型和循环体的执行次数,正确的选项是( B)A当型循环,20 次B直到型循环,10 次C当型循环,10 次D直到型循环,20 次26、在程序中,使用 InputBox 函数可以接受用户的输入,如果要把它的返回值转换为数值型的数据,应该使用的函数是(A )AValBLenCStr DLog27、动态数组因为在程序运行前无法确定数组的大小,所以经常根据程序的运行情况,对数组进行重新定义,以下关于 VB 中动

14、态数组的叙述中不正确的是( B)A可以用 ReDim 语句重新定义动态数组,并且可以进行多次重定义B首次用 Dim 进行动态数组声明的时候,必须指明它的类型和上下界CPreserve 为 ReDim 语句的可选参数,用于保留动态数组原来的内容D当对动态数组使用 Erase 语句进行释放操作时,将释放其内存28、VB 中的控件也叫做部件或组件,主要包括三类,以下哪一项不属于 VB 控件的分类(C )A控件 B可插入对象CADO 控件 DActiveX 控件29、表达式 4+5 6 * 7 / 8 Mod 9 的值是(B )A4 B5 C6 D730、可以同时删除字符串前导和尾部空白的函数是( C)ALtrim BRtrim CTrim DMid1、当程序运行时,在窗体上单击鼠标,以下哪个事件是窗体不会接收到( )AMouseDownBMouseUpCLoad DClick2、窗体 Form1 的 Name 属性是 Frm1,它的单击事件过程名是( )AForm1_Click BForm_Click CFrm1_Click DMe_Click3、用于设置通用对话框控件显示文件类型的属性是( )AFilter BPath CPartern DFoleName4、用于从内存删除窗体的命令是( )AMove BHide CUnload DDelete5、

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> 其它办公文档

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号